An example of a exceptional answer:
As a Child and Adolescent Psychiatrist, I understand the sensitive nature of the information shared by young patients and the importance of maintaining their privacy and confidentiality. Beyond the standard protocols and guidelines, I go the extra mile to ensure the highest level of privacy protection. I utilize secure electronic health record systems that require multi-factor authentication to access patient information, adding an extra layer of security. I also use encrypted communication platforms to securely communicate with patients and their families. In my practice, I strictly limit access to patient files, ensuring that only authorized individuals involved in their care can access the information. To further protect patient privacy, I conduct regular audits to identify any potential vulnerabilities in our systems and address them promptly. Lastly, I emphasize ongoing education for both myself and my team to stay current with emerging privacy laws and technologies. By implementing these comprehensive measures, I create a privacy-conscious environment where young patients can feel safe and confident in sharing their experiences and concerns.

How to prepare for this question:
  • Familiarize yourself with relevant privacy laws and regulations in child and adolescent psychiatry.
  • Research and understand the importance of patient privacy and confidentiality in mental healthcare.
  • Stay informed about best practices for safeguarding electronic health records and secure communication platforms.
  • Consider discussing any experience or training in privacy protection during the interview to showcase your commitment to this aspect of the job.
